首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在Angular和Typescript中使用select选项的数组

在Angular和Typescript中,我们可以使用select选项的数组来实现下拉选择框的功能。下面是完善且全面的答案:

在Angular中,select选项的数组可以通过定义一个数组变量来实现。该数组可以包含多个对象,每个对象代表一个选项,包括选项的值和显示文本。例如:

代码语言:txt
复制
options: any[] = [
  { value: 'option1', text: 'Option 1' },
  { value: 'option2', text: 'Option 2' },
  { value: 'option3', text: 'Option 3' }
];

在上面的示例中,我们定义了一个名为options的数组,包含了三个选项。每个选项都是一个对象,包含了valuetext两个属性,分别表示选项的值和显示文本。

接下来,我们可以在HTML模板中使用ngFor指令来遍历options数组,并将每个选项渲染为一个option元素。同时,我们可以使用ngModel指令来绑定选择框的值到一个变量上。例如:

代码语言:txt
复制
<select [(ngModel)]="selectedOption">
  <option *ngFor="let option of options" [value]="option.value">{{ option.text }}</option>
</select>

在上面的示例中,我们使用ngFor指令遍历options数组,并将每个选项渲染为一个option元素。通过[value]属性绑定选项的值,通过{{ option.text }}插值表达式显示选项的文本。同时,我们使用[(ngModel)]指令将选择框的值双向绑定到一个名为selectedOption的变量上。

通过上述代码,我们就可以在Angular和Typescript中使用select选项的数组来实现下拉选择框的功能了。

推荐的腾讯云相关产品和产品介绍链接地址:

  • 腾讯云云服务器(CVM):提供可扩展的云服务器实例,满足不同规模和需求的应用场景。详情请参考:腾讯云云服务器
  • 腾讯云云数据库MySQL版:提供高性能、可扩展的云数据库服务,适用于各种规模的应用。详情请参考:腾讯云云数据库MySQL版
  • 腾讯云对象存储(COS):提供安全可靠、高扩展性的云端存储服务,适用于存储和处理各种类型的数据。详情请参考:腾讯云对象存储
  • 腾讯云人工智能平台(AI Lab):提供丰富的人工智能服务和工具,帮助开发者构建智能化应用。详情请参考:腾讯云人工智能平台
  • 腾讯云物联网平台(IoT Explorer):提供全面的物联网解决方案,帮助开发者快速构建和管理物联网设备。详情请参考:腾讯云物联网平台
  • 腾讯云区块链服务(Tencent Blockchain):提供安全可信的区块链服务,支持快速搭建和管理区块链网络。详情请参考:腾讯云区块链服务

以上是关于在Angular和Typescript中使用select选项的数组的完善且全面的答案,希望对您有帮助。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

27分24秒

051.尚硅谷_Flink-状态管理(三)_状态在代码中的定义和使用

13分46秒

16.尚硅谷-IDEA-版本控制在IDEA中的配置和使用.avi

13分46秒

16.尚硅谷-IDEA-版本控制在IDEA中的配置和使用.avi

11分33秒

061.go数组的使用场景

7分8秒

059.go数组的引入

38秒

Lightroom Classic教程:如何在Mac Lightroom 中创建黑色电影效果

1分28秒

PS小白教程:如何在Photoshop中制作出镂空文字?

3分0秒

四轴飞行器在ROS、Gazebo和Simulink中的路径跟踪和障碍物规避

1分51秒

Ranorex Studio简介

4分36秒

PS小白教程:如何在Photoshop中制作雨天玻璃文字效果?

7分44秒

087.sync.Map的基本使用

1分10秒

PS小白教程:如何在Photoshop中制作透明玻璃效果?

领券